Meaning of Entity
The primary meaning of the word "Entity" refers to a thing with distinct and independent existence, whether it is a living being, an organization, or an abstract concept.
Definitions
- A thing with distinct and independent existence, whether living or non-living
- * An organization or institution, such as a business or corporation
- * A concept or abstraction, such as a idea or notion
Etymology of Entity
The word "Entity" originated from the Old French word "entité", which is derived from the Latin word "entitas", meaning "being" or "existence"
The Latin word "entitas" is itself derived from the verb "esse", which means "to be"
The word "Entity" has been used in English since the 15th century to refer to a thing or being with distinct existence
